Review of Dubuque, Iowa


Positive recent changes for DBQ!!!
Star Rating - 6/3/2009
If you are looking for a place to move, but don't think Iowa is appealing, you might want to consider Dubuque. DBQ is far from the flat farm land that you might think of when you think of Iowa. The Mississippi and the river bluffs provide outstanding natural beauty. I was born & raised in DBQ. I now live in a different city, but my family is still in DBQ and I regularly visit. I am very happy for the changes in the city since I left. I have read other reviews about the ugly warehouses and deteriorating homes... much of that is changing.

The city has taken many steps to revitilize the riverfront. They have removed many of the old warehouses and the old packing house in order to create a new park and walking place along the river. They also opened up the downtown plaza to traffic in order to spur economic development. It really is very pretty.

DBQ has also had some recent economic growth. IBM has taken a new residence in what had previously been a dead downtown area and will be creating 1,300 new jobs. There is a new meat packing plant being constructed also, this time on the outskirts of town so the smell should not affect too many residential neighborhoods like the old one.

There are still areas of town, especially the lower Rhomberg Avenue area, which are in desparatate need of an "Extreme Makeover." The city should consider a plan to either fix up these homes or bulldoze them. (They are not of any historical significance.)

So, if you are looking for a great place to raise a family, consider Dubuque. The schools are very good, the city is clean, the crime rate is low and the cost of living is incredibly affordable.

The "new meat packing plant" is actually a processing facility for shelf-stable products and will not emit "smell" to affect anyone. Nothing like the slaughterhouse of days gone by.
